From a tuning standpoint, their's a big difference between even a basic turbo set up and a bolt on s2k. Someone comfortable tuning boosted motors might not be comfortable tuning all-motor ones and vise versa.

Re: Who should tune my AP1(AEM EMS)?
You should be looking for someone who is confident tuning with an AEM... You could have the best all motor sk2 tuner out there tuning your car, but if he has never touched an AEM it will be a nightmare for him...
